Can you use ceramic pots on glass stove?
Ceramic. It is not recommended to use true ceramic cookware on glass-top stoves because of its rough texture. Since most items labeled as ceramic are actually metal with a silicone coating that makes them nonstick, they’re not actually ceramic at all.
